Maintaining a flawless skin appearance requires more than just good genes—it necessitates a committed skin maintenance routine. The skin, being our most expansive organ, it is subject to constant external aggressors, ultraviolet radiation, and multiple factors that influence its health and appearance. A daily routine featuring cleansing, hydration, masques, concentrated treatments, and facial oils is key to keeping skin that remains youthful and resilient.
Washing the face every day lays the groundwork of any effective skincare routine. Over time, the skin accumulates grime, sebum, and pollutants, if left unchecked, often result in breakouts, dullness, and skin issues. Cleansing eliminates these residues, ensuring an unclogged skin surface. Yet, one must to choose a non-irritating face wash tailored to individual concerns to avoid dehydration. Using harsh cleansers might remove natural oils, causing inflammation. Those with delicate skin benefit from dermatologist-recommended products. Those with excess sebum benefit from oil-controlling products that deeply clean without excessive dryness. Nourishing products work best for dry skin, ensuring hydration while cleansing.
Following cleansing, moisturizing is a must for protecting the skin. Moisturizers help to replenish hydration, reducing the chances of dryness and irritation. Every skin type, moisturization is beneficial. People dealing with acne can opt for lightweight skin balancers that nourish without clogging pores. Parched complexions, a richer sustainable facial oils product can work wonders. People with fluctuating skin needs requires balanced hydration to maintain equilibrium. With consistent use, properly chosen products helps keep youthful plumpness.
Facial oils are highly recommended for their ability to deeply nourish. Unlike conventional moisturizers, beauty oils penetrate deeper to provide long-lasting hydration. Oils like rosehip oil, packed with essential fatty acids, help to repair. For individuals with excessive sebum, lightweight oils such as squalane regulate oil production. Aging skin see the most results with richer oils such as avocado, that improve suppleness. Adding a beauty oil into your skincare practice supports a plump complexion, leading to improved skin texture.
